William Meade Fishback (born November 5, 1831 in Jefferson, Virginia; died February 9, 1903 in Fort Smith, Arkansas) succeeded James Philip Eagle as the seventeenth Governor of Arkansas, serving between January 10, 1893 and January 8, 1895. Following the end of Fishback's term in office, James Paul Clarke (born August 18, 1854 in Yazoo City, Mississippi; died October 1, 1916 in Little Rock, Arkansas) became the eighteenth Governor of Arkansas, serving between January 8, 1895 and January 12, 1897.
